Why These Are the Top Flooring Installers Contractors in Port Charlotte

** The flooring installers market in Port Charlotte, Florida, is robust and competitive, largely driven by the region's active real estate market and a high volume of both new construction and home renovation projects, particularly from retirees and seasonal residents. The average quality of service providers is good, with a clear distinction between established, licensed contractors and smaller, less formal operations. **Competition Level:** High. There are numerous providers, but the top-tier companies distinguish themselves through professional certifications, strong online reputations, and long-term local presence. **Typical Pricing:** Pricing is moderately competitive. As a general guide, material costs vary widely, but professional installation typically falls within these ranges: * **Carpet:** $3 - $7 per square foot (installed) * **Laminate/LVP:** $4 - $9+ per square foot (installed) * **Tile:** $7 - $15+ per square foot (installed) * **Hardwood:** $10 - $20+ per square foot (installed) Consumers are advised to obtain multiple quotes and verify state licensing (via the Florida Department of Business and Professional Regulation) and insurance before committing to any contractor. The top providers, like those listed above, often command a premium justified by their expertise, warranty offerings, and reliable service.

Frequently Asked Questions About Flooring Installers in Port Charlotte

Get answers to common questions about flooring installers services in Port Charlotte, Florida.

1How does Port Charlotte's humid, subtropical climate affect my choice of flooring?

High humidity and salt air near the coast make moisture resistance a top priority. We strongly recommend materials like luxury vinyl plank (LVP), tile, or engineered hardwood over solid hardwood, which can warp. Proper acclimation of materials in your home for 48-72 hours before installation is a non-negotiable step here to prevent buckling and gaps.

2What is the typical timeline for a flooring installation project in Port Charlotte?

After material selection, most residential installations take 1-3 days, depending on square footage. However, scheduling can be impacted by Florida's seasonal influx of "snowbirds"; the busiest period is from October to April. To ensure availability, it's best to book your installation several weeks in advance, especially for popular materials like waterproof LVP.

3Are there specific permits or regulations for flooring installation in Charlotte County?

For standard replacement flooring in an existing home, a permit is typically not required in unincorporated Charlotte County or Port Charlotte. However, if the project is part of a larger renovation that alters the home's structure or involves new construction, you should verify with the Charlotte County Building Division. Reputable local installers will know and handle any necessary compliance.

4What should I look for when choosing a local flooring installer in Port Charlotte?

Always verify they are licensed (a Florida state-certified or Charlotte County-registered contractor's license for the scope of work), insured, and provide local references. Look for extensive experience with our climate-specific challenges, like moisture barriers for concrete slabs. Be wary of contractors who only operate during season; a year-round local business is often more reliable.

5Why is a moisture test critical for installations on concrete slabs in this area?

Nearly all Port Charlotte homes are built on concrete slabs at or near sea level, making them highly susceptible to ground moisture vapor transmission (MVT). A professional moisture test (calcium chloride or relative humidity) is essential before installing any non-permeable flooring like vinyl or laminate. Without a proper moisture barrier or vapor retarder, moisture will wick up, ruining the adhesive and flooring.
